mcpcatalogs
An MCP server that lets your AI assistant query mcpcatalogs.com — the independent bilingual directory of MCP servers — directly inside the chat. Search, compare, top-list, and dive into full server details without leaving your IDE or Claude Desktop.
The directory tracks 1,900+ MCP servers, refreshed daily with composite scores combining AI evaluation, GitHub signals, and real-world Smithery usage.
Tools
| Tool | What it does |
|---|---|
search_mcp_servers |
Free-text search by topic, optional category narrowing |
get_server_detail |
Full record: install, FAQ, "when to choose / when NOT", alternatives |
compare_servers |
Side-by-side comparison between two servers (stars, usage, score, decision-guide) |
list_top |
Ranked list by composite quality / GitHub stars / real Smithery usage |
All four return clean markdown — drop-in citation source for LLM answers.
Install
Claude Desktop
Edit your Claude Desktop config:
- macOS:
~/Library/Application Support/Claude/claude_desktop_config.json - Windows:
%APPDATA%\Claude\claude_desktop_config.json - Linux:
~/.config/Claude/claude_desktop_config.json
Add:
{
"mcpServers": {
"mcpcatalogs": {
"command": "npx",
"args": ["-y", "mcpcatalogs"]
}
}
}
Restart Claude Desktop. You should see four new tools in the tools menu.
Cursor
In Cursor → Settings → Features → MCP:
{
"mcpcatalogs": {
"command": "npx",
"args": ["-y", "mcpcatalogs"]
}
}
Cline / Continue / other MCP-aware clients
Same shape — point the client at npx -y mcpcatalogs.
Direct HTTP (no install)
If your client supports remote MCP servers over HTTP:
{
"mcpServers": {
"mcpcatalogs": {
"url": "https://mcpcatalogs.com/mcp"
}
}
}

Data freshness
The directory refreshes daily from GitHub + Smithery. Each tool call hits a live database, so you always get the latest score, last-commit date, and usage numbers.
Local development
git clone https://github.com/mcpcatalogs/mcpcatalogs
cd mcpcatalogs
npm install
npm run build
node dist/index.js
To point at a custom backend (e.g. a fork), set environment variables:
export MCPCATALOGS_SUPABASE_URL=https://your-project.supabase.co
export MCPCATALOGS_SUPABASE_ANON_KEY=your-anon-key
